# Welcome to the Quarrelstone data platform repo. All SQL files under ./queries are linted by sqlshine on every commit; keywords must be uppercase, joins explicit, and no SELECT * outside scratch folders. The linter config lives in .sqlshine.yml — don't edit it without a review from the schema guild. Fix violations locally with `make lintfix` before pushing, since CI blocks merges on any warning. The lint service authenticates against our Pellworth rules registry, and the credential it uses is set on the next line.

sealed setting: RELAY_SECRET5=82864

### Address Autocomplete Widget — Quickstart

The Mapnickel autocomplete widget drops into any form with one script tag and a container div. It debounces keystrokes at 250ms and returns up to five suggestions scoped to the regions you configure. Heads up: suggestions come from our internal geocoder, not a public endpoint, so requests won't work from localhost without the proxy. To authenticate the widget against the geocoder, use the key below.

service key, kaduf-bawig: kto15_Ze79S0dligTw0yO

TURN-208: Gatevale turnstile counters at the Merrow Field pilot double-count when a rotation reverses mid-cycle. Attendance totals drift roughly 2% high per event. The debounce window fix is implemented, reviewed by Ilsa, and soak-tested across two simulated match days without drift. Ready for your cut; the candidate build is identified below.

trace token, tagag-tafog: htk6_5ed18c